FAQs for booking London Gatwick Airport to Montego Bay flights

  • Where do flights from Gatwick to Montego Bay stop?

    Most flights from Gatwick to Montego Bay include two stops. American Airlines runs two main routes. One has flights stopping in Orlando (MCA) and in Miami (MIA). The other usually stops in New York at JFK and at Charlotte Douglas Airport (CLT). WestJet flights usually stop in Calgary (YYC) and Toronto Pearson International Airport (YYZ).

  • How much luggage can I bring on Alaska Airlines?

    On most Alaska Airlines flights, you'll be allowed to bring one personal item and one piece of carry-on luggage. You can book checked luggage as an extra. You may also be entitled to two bags of checked luggage for free if you are a high-level Oneworld member or if you carry certain credit cards.

  • How much checked luggage can I bring on WestJet flights to Montego Bay?

    WestJet has four different Economy fare types. On their Basic and Econo fares, checked luggage isn't automatically included. You can book it online and booking it ahead of time is usually cheaper than doing so at the airport. If you book their EconoFlex fare, you can bring one checked bag weighing up to 23 kg. With their Premium fares, you are allowed to bring two 23 kg checked bags.

  • How much cabin luggage can I bring on American Airlines flights to Montego Bay?

    On American Airlines flights from Gatwick to Montego Bay, you can bring one piece of carry-on luggage weighing up to 10 kg. It must be 56 x 36 x 23 cm or smaller. You can also bring a small personal item no larger than 45 x 35 x 20 cm. It should be stored under the seat in front of you during the flight.

KAYAK’s top tips for finding a cheap flight from London Gatwick Airport to Montego Bay

  • Looking for a cheap flight from Montego Bay to London Gatwick Airport? 25% of our users found flights on this route for Montego Bay or less round-trip.
  • Finnair and Jet Blue often combine for flights between London Gatwick Airport (LGW) and Montego Bay Sangster International Airport (MBJ). If you book one of these routes, it's a good idea to check with Finnair to see which airline's luggage rules you need to follow for the full flight.
  • Alaska Airlines usually operates the only flights from Gatwick to Montego Bay with just one stop. While most of their routes stop at both John F. Kennedy International Airport (JFK) and Atlanta Hartsfield–Jackson International Airport (ATL), some stop just once at JFK.
  • If you're looking for more route options from London to Montego Bay, you can also look at flights departing from London Heathrow Airport (LHR). Virgin Atlantic offers routes departing from Heathrow with a single stop at Nassau International Airport.
  • Alaska Airlines doesn't usually include a meal in the price of their Economy tickets. You can however, buy food during the flight such as fruit and cheese platters, and Kid's Picnic Packs. You can also use the Alaska Airlines app to book your meal ahead of time to ensure you get your preferred choice.
  • American Airlines doesn't usually include checked luggage on flights to Jamaica so you'll have to pay a modest fee to book them as an extra. You can book up to five bags in total. If you are a Oneworld member or hold an AAdvantage Credit Card, you may be entitled to complimentary checked baggage.
